The range of concrete driveway finishes includes options such as stamped patterns, exposed aggregate, brushed textures, and integral coloring. These finishes can transform a plain slab into a visually interesting surface that adds character and style. For instance, stamped concrete can mimic the look of stone or brick, offering a decorative yet durable solution. Exposed aggregate finishes reveal small stones on the surface, providing a textured grip that’s ideal for driveways exposed to weather. Each finish has its own maintenance considerations and aesthetic appeal, making it important to work with local contractors who understand how to properly apply and maintain these options over time.

What are common concrete driveway design options and finishes? Common options include stamped patterns, exposed aggregate, colored concrete, and smooth or brushed finishes, allowing for customization to match various styles.
How can local contractors help customize concrete driveway finishes? Local contractors can recommend and apply a variety of finishes and design options based on the property's style and the homeowner’s preferences, ensuring a tailored look.
Are decorative finishes durable for concrete driveways? Yes, many decorative finishes, such as stamped or exposed aggregate, are designed to be durable and withstand regular use when properly installed by experienced service providers.
What types of patterns are available for stamped concrete driveways? Popular patterns include brick, cobblestone, slate, and random stone, which can be customized with different colors and textures for a unique appearance.

Stamped concrete finishes - property owners can explore stamped concrete to add textured patterns that mimic brick or stone, enhancing curb appeal with the help of local contractors.
Exposed aggregate surfaces - choosing exposed aggregate finishes can create a slip-resistant and decorative driveway surface, ideal for high-traffic areas with the assistance of local service providers.
Colored concrete options - applying integral or overlay colors allows property owners to customize the look of their driveway, working with local pros to achieve a vibrant or subtle hue.
Broom finish textures - a simple broom finish can provide a non-slip surface with a clean, matte appearance, easily applied by local contractors during driveway installation or resurfacing.
